Inflation accelerates, base rate hike is likely in March
KAZAKHSTAN · In Brief · 03 Mar 2025
The Bureau of National Statistics reported that in February, inflation m-o-m accelerated to 1.5% (versus 1.1% m-o-m in January). The y-o-y tally climbed to 9.4% (versus 8.9% in January). Ministerial reform strengthens inner circle but fails to address a major challenge
BRAZIL POLITICS · Report · 28 Feb 2025
President Lula’s (PT) ministerial reform has begun with risky moves. The Minister of Health, Nísia Trindade, has been replaced by the Minister of Institutional Relations, Alexandre Padilha (PT), confirming Trindade’s political sidelining.
